1958 Western Open Scorecard Signed by Tony Lema & Mike Dietz
A signed official scorecard from the 1958 Western Open by Contestant Mike Dietz and Tony Lema is available to bidders in this lot. Both golfers signed Dietz's official scorecard in pencil following the opening round at Red Run Golf Club near Detroit. The 1958 Western Open was a one stroke victory by Doug Sanders over Dow Finsterwald. What makes this scorecard attractive in auction is the autograph from Tony Lema. Lema won the 1964 British Open at St. Andrews and was a promising golfer on Tour until his untimely death in 1966 at age 32. In his shortened golf career, Tony Lema won 12 PGA Tour events and 22 times professionally. Autographed items from Tony Lema typically yield major interest from bidders. This 1958 Western Open scorecard comes in good condition.
James Spence Authentication (JSA) has reviewed the autographs and their certification of its authenticity will come with this lot.
